The Story
In late March 2026, a wave of complaints emerged from users of the Gemini AI tool concerning its erratic outputs. Users reported instances where instead of generating scripts or business presentations, the tool began producing flirtatious messages and unrelated text. These incidents were not isolated; multiple reports flooded social media and forums, with users expressing frustration and confusion over the AI's unexpected behavior. The most striking example came from a user who specifically requested a script for a presentation, only to receive a string of suggestive texts instead. As the news spread, it became clear that a significant number of users experienced similar issues, raising questions about Gemini's underlying algorithms and their ability to maintain contextual relevance.
